Factors to Consider When Selecting a Truck Accident Lawyer

When selecting a truck accident lawyer, there are a variety of factors to consider. An experienced lawyer has access to numerous resources that will help you build the best possible claim. In the beginning, you must collect as much information as possible. This includes taking photographs of the scene of your accident, including all vehicles involved, the damage to the area around it, tire skid marks on the road surface and more. It is also important to collect photographs immediately after the accident, as well as at each major stage of your recovery.

Experience

If you've been involved in a truck accident, you need a truck accident lawyer who is experienced in the field. A lawyer for truck accidents is specialized in the type of accident that you are facing, as opposed to general lawyers. They are knowledgeable of state and federal laws, and they know how to build a case that will effectively make the responsible party accountable for their actions.

Lawyers for Truck Accident Lawsuits accidents are familiar with the intricacies and complexities of the personal injury industry and can help you assess the value of your case. Trucking cases are a challenge due to the unique insurance coverage issues that are involved. In addition a lawyer who handles truck accidents must have a thorough understanding of the industry and how to negotiate with the largest trucking firms.

A truck accident lawyer is also experienced in how to gather evidence to support the case. The lawyer can collect medical records, police records and photographs of the scene of the crash. Witness statements are also possible. Truck accidents can be a bit complicated and require a lot of evidence to prove the liability. In addition your lawyer will need to obtain information from government agencies as well as the truck driver's employer.

Accidents involving trucks can be devastating for all involved. They can cause serious injuries or fatalities. Most accidents involving trucks occur when the driver of a truck isn't operating the truck in a safe way. commercial vehicle. Truck drivers must be aware of their blind spots and pay attention to traffic laws. The trucking company may be accountable for the negligent operation of the vehicle. Trucking companies could also be held responsible if the driver is found to have violated federal rules.

Identifying the parties liable

Truck accidents can involve multiple parties, including trucking companies and automobile manufacturers. They could be accountable for the accident if their equipment weren't properly maintained. If the road conditions were unsafe, or there were no signs or functioning lights in the area, the federal or state government could be held responsible. Truck drivers may also be held accountable for their own actions. An attorney with expertise in these kinds of accidents can help identify the parties at fault.

Once you've identified any responsible parties then you'll have to contact their insurance companies. Many insurance companies will be fighting to determine who's accountable. Because these accidents can cause lots of damage and cost money, insurance companies are interested to determine who is at fault. So, they'll do everything they can to try to minimize the liability. It is essential to identify the parties who are responsible to determine the amount of compensation you're entitled to following a car accident.

You may file a negligence claim against the trucking firm if the driver of the truck is at fault. In many cases, employers will share liability for the actions of their employees however, there are some exceptions. For instance, the company could be responsible for an accident that caused death to a person if the driver was driving under the effects of alcohol or drugs or when a truck driver was tired or distracted at the time of the accident. Trucking companies could also be held responsible if cargo was improperly loaded or not properly secured.

Cost

The cost of hiring a truck accident lawyer depends on several aspects, including the nature of case, the circumstances of the accident, and the type of legal proceedings required to win compensation. The average attorney's fee is between 30-40 % of the total settlement. In some cases, fees may be higher. You should discuss the cost with your lawyer prior to signing any contract.

Although you can find a lot of information on the internet regarding truck accidents, a lawyer will offer advice depending on the specific circumstances. A consultation with an attorney to review the details of your case will ensure that you get the best possible outcome. An attorney can also help learn about the process involved in creating your case. For instance hiring an expert to design a model for accident reconstruction could cost a significant amount of money, but it will make your case stronger.

It is important to determine whether a lawyer is working on a basis of a contingent fee or an hourly rate when choosing a lawyer. The former is better because you don't need to worry about paying attorney's fees if the case doesn't win. Some lawyers won't accept truck accident cases on contingency and might prefer to charge an hourly rate.
